轻松几步,玩转Node.js版本升级:升级指南和实操步骤
2023-04-29 15:08:27
Node.js 版本升级:解锁更强大的开发者工具
作为一名 Node.js 开发者,紧跟最新版本的脚步至关重要。新版本带来了增强功能、优化性能和更完善的支持,让您在开发中如虎添翼。以下是一份全面指南,帮助您轻松完成 Node.js 版本升级,从而开启更具挑战性项目的征程。
1. 当前版本检查:了解您的起点
第一步,您需要了解您当前的 Node.js 版本。在命令行中输入以下命令:
node -v
终端将输出您的 Node.js 版本号。
2. 下载新版本:拥抱技术的进步
现在,您已获悉当前版本,是时候升级到最新版本了。您可以从 Node.js 官方网站下载新版本。在下载页面中,您可以查看所有可用的版本。选择您需要的版本并点击下载按钮。
3. 替换旧版本文件:完成变革
下载完成后,您需要用新版本文件替换旧版本文件。此过程涉及几个步骤:
- 找到 Node.js 的安装路径。
- 打开 Node.js 安装文件夹。
- 将旧版本 Node.js 文件复制到其他文件夹中。
- 将新版本 Node.js 文件复制到 Node.js 安装文件夹中。
4. 验证版本升级:确认无误
最后,您需要验证版本升级是否成功。在命令行中输入以下命令:
node -v
终端将输出新版本的 Node.js 版本号。
5. 常见问题解答:解决疑虑
在版本升级过程中,您可能会遇到一些问题。以下是常见问题及其解决方案:
1. 升级后出现错误:沉着应对,排查问题
如果升级后出现错误,可能是因为新版本的 Node.js 与您的项目不兼容。尝试以下方法解决问题:
- 检查您的项目是否与新版本 Node.js 兼容。
- 尝试更新您的项目以使其与新版本 Node.js 兼容。
2. 升级后某些功能无法使用:从容应对,寻找替代方案
如果在升级后发现某些功能无法使用,可能是因为这些功能在新版本的 Node.js 中已被弃用。尝试以下方法解决问题:
- 检查这些功能是否在新版本 Node.js 中已被弃用。
- 寻找这些功能的替代方案。
3. 升级后性能下降:深究原因,优化性能
如果在升级后发现性能下降,可能是因为新版本的 Node.js 与您的硬件不兼容。尝试以下方法解决问题:
- 检查您的硬件是否与新版本 Node.js 兼容。
- 尝试优化您的代码以使其在新版本 Node.js 中运行得更快。
结论:掌握升级,掌控未来
Node.js 版本升级是开发旅程中的重要一步,它可以让您释放更强大的工具并迎接更具挑战性的项目。通过本指南,您已掌握了版本升级的详细步骤和常见问题的解决方案。愿您在 Node.js 开发的道路上轻松迈进,不断探索和创新。
代码示例:
// 检查当前版本
console.log(`当前 Node.js 版本:${process.version}`);
// 下载新版本
// (此处应替换为您的系统和版本信息)
const downloadUrl = "https://nodejs.org/dist/v18.12.1/node-v18.12.1.pkg";
const download = await fetch(downloadUrl);
const buffer = await download.arrayBuffer();
// 替换旧版本文件
// (此处应替换为您的 Node.js 安装路径)
const nodeJsPath = "/usr/local/bin/node";
fs.writeFileSync(nodeJsPath, Buffer.from(buffer));
// 验证版本升级
console.log(`新 Node.js 版本:${process.version}`);